    [quote][b]LOU DOBBS TO LAUNCH NATIONAL RADIO TALK SHOW IN PARTNERSHIP WITH UNITED STATIONS RADIO NETWORKS, INC.


    Prominent CNN Anchor and Best-Selling Author to Hit the Afternoon Airwaves

    Each Weekday Beginning March, 2008


    The Lou Dobbs Show Will Occupy Gap Between Conservative and Liberal Talk Radio


    New York, NY – December 4, 2007 – Award-winning broadcast journalist and author Lou Dobbs announced today that he will be bringing his influential and popular point of view to a coast-to-coast radio audience with a new daily Talk Show. The show, tentatively titled The Lou Dobbs Show , will be produced, distributed to affiliates and sold to advertisers by United Stations Radio Networks, Inc. (“USRNâ€

    just read...

    I just read , again, how Ron Paul would deal with the ones here. He is definately against ANY hint of amnesty because he says that will just make more come over. He said he thinks it would be impossible to find all who are here, but no illegals should get free school, welfare, jobs, medical..etc..and he is not ok that police can't ask for id 's. He says if we get rid of the incentives they will leave on their own. He is of the mind that they get rewarded for coming here ...you know..the welfare state. He said if churches wanted to help them with medical..he wasn't opposed to that because it's a charity. His concern is taxes...killing the taxpayers.
